John V. Brennan coordinated with logistical staff to prepare a telephonic connection for President Nixon to address a reception honoring Senator John G. Tower. The participants confirmed the technical readiness of the 'Super Q' line to ensure high audio quality for the call. They finalized the arrangement to initiate the connection to the event upon receiving further notification, with the Senator having already notified attendees of the impending call.
On October 29, 1972, John V. Brennan and unknown person(s) talked on the telephone at Camp David at an unknown time between 7:55 pm and 8:58 pm. The Camp David Study Table taping system captured this recording, which is known as Conversation 152-001 of the White House Tapes.
